There's only really one good controller for the CDi and it's bloody expensive. I only have one, so I opened it up, made a note of everything and set about replicating the circuit board. The idea was that this way I could make as many as I want and use "donor" controllers to wire them to. Obviously I normally use controllers I really like - Saturn, Mega Drive....In this case a Mega Drive like plug & play system controller.

It's pretty much just pictures at the moment, but I'll have more info up eventually.

Pin 18 is for up, so I later wired this to a SPDT switch (middle) then wired C and Up on the D-Pad to either end so that if Up = Jump in a game you can use the C button instead.

Making a start on the second one...

Adding a couple of stickers to make it official.

